If you’ve never experienced paddle boarding, no problem! There are several rental companies around town that would love to show you the ropes:  

Atlantic Watersports: Located in the heart of North Myrtle Beach on Ocean Boulevard, Atlantic Watersports offers paddle boarding, surfing, parasailing and jet ski excursions. 

Great Escapes Kayak Expeditions: With locations across the Grand Strand, you can book a paddle boarding or kayaking trip on Waites Island, the Waccamaw River, and the Cherry Grove Marsh. 

Trailblaze Adventures: At Traiblaze Adventures, you can explore the untouched landscape of Waites Island on a guided paddle board or kayak tour.

For paddle boarders who already have boards and equipment, there are several spots around town to launch:  

The Cherry Grove neighborhood is home to the Cherry Grove Fishing Pier and one of the best beaches in America, according to the readers of USA Today. It’s also home to the Cherry Grove Park and Boat Ramp.  Aside from a place to drop in the water, you can also access the Pier and the Heritage Shores Nature Preserve

Nature enthusiasts should check out the Waccamaw River Blue Trail! This black water ecosystem is home to 16 public launch points.
